Promoting Ease of Travel with E-Tourist Visas

One of the most notable aspects of these new agreements is the facilitation of smoother travel between India and Russia. Under the agreements, citizens of both countries will now be eligible for a 30-day e-tourist visa, available on a gratis basis. This simplified visa process is expected to increase the number of tourists traveling between the two nations, providing a boost to the tourism sectors in both countries.

The introduction of the free e-visa for travel reflects the growing recognition of tourism as a key driver of bilateral ties. By easing entry restrictions, both India and Russia are aiming to attract more visitors, allowing for greater exploration of each other’s diverse landscapes, culture, and history.

Skilled Worker Mobility for Enhanced Professional Exchange

In addition to simplifying travel, the two countries have also signed a labour mobility agreement. This agreement aims to foster temporary employment opportunities for citizens of each country, creating avenues for professional exchange and collaboration. The movement of skilled workers between India and Russia will not only benefit individuals seeking international experience but also strengthen economic collaboration, particularly in sectors that require specialized knowledge and expertise.

This agreement marks a significant step in enhancing the labor mobility between the two nations. It paves the way for a robust exchange of talent and ideas, which can lead to better cooperation in critical industries and sectors, particularly in science, technology, engineering, and healthcare.

Cultural Exchange Initiatives to Strengthen People-to-People Ties

The agreements also place a strong emphasis on cultural and people-to-people exchanges, recognizing these as vital elements of the strategic partnership. Both countries have expressed a commitment to enhancing their cultural interactions, including participation in international cultural forums, book fairs, art exhibitions, and festivals.

As part of this initiative, Cultural Exchange Festivals will be held in both countries on a parity basis. These festivals will serve as platforms to showcase the rich and diverse cultural heritage of India and Russia, fostering greater mutual understanding. By encouraging direct engagement between citizens of both nations, these initiatives are expected to build long-lasting personal and professional relationships.

Collaborating in the Film Industry

The cultural focus extends to the film industry as well, where both countries have pledged to deepen cooperation. Joint film productions are set to rise, with opportunities for mutual participation in international film festivals hosted in India and Russia. This partnership will not only support the growth of the film industry in both nations but also serve as a means to showcase the artistic talent from both countries on the global stage.

India’s growing film industry and Russia’s rich history in cinematic arts provide a solid foundation for a fruitful collaboration that could create new opportunities for filmmakers, actors, and other professionals in the entertainment sector.
